Panera Bread
Takes Manhattan with Opening of 1,500th
Store
Opens in Manhattan with Plans for Four Bakery-Cafes in 2012
ST. LOUIS, MO,February 7, 2012 Today Panera Bread (Nasdaq: PNRA) announced the opening of
its 1,500th
bakery-cafe and its first in Manhattan.
The Companys new location opened today at 330 Seventh Avenue at 29th
Street. As well, Panera Bread
announced three other Manhattan bakery-cafes that it expects to open in 2012. They will be located on
East 86th Street, Fifth Avenue at 40th Street and Union Square.
We are thrilled to be celebrating two milestones today the opening of our 1,500th
bakery-cafe, as well
as Paneras entry into the food mecca that is Manhattan, commented Ron Shaich, Panera Bread Founder
and Executive Chairman. While New York City consumers have their pick of options, we believe that
the Panera experience high-quality food rooted in hand-crafted, artisan bread, served in a warm and
welcoming environment by people who care will distinguish Panera from the rest. Not only are we
excited about opening our 1,500th
bakery-cafe but were pleased about joining four neighborhoods across
Manhattan over the coming months.
New to New Yorkers but a favorite of the commuting set
Panera Bread currently operates 90 bakery-cafes in the Tri-State area and has long been a preferred
destination of the New York commuter crowd. In 2010 Panera Bread was ranked highest in customer
satisfaction among Quick Service Restaurants in New York by J.D. Power and Associates.
Residents of the Tri-State certainly know Panera well as we have, in a sense, surrounded Manhattan with
cafes in the other boroughs, commented Bill Moreton, Panera Breads Chief Executive Officer and
President. Many of our fans outside Manhattan, including Long Island, New Jersey and Connecticut,
have been asking us to come to Manhattan for quite some time and were happy to do that for them today.
For New Yorkers who have yet to visit a Panera, we welcome them to visit to our new Seventh Avenue
location.
Panera Bread increasingly operates bakery-cafes in high-density metropolitan areas including Boston,
Chicago, Washington, D.C., Los Angeles and Toronto. Having been successful in some of the countrys
largest cities, we felt it was time for us to be in Manhattan, Shaich said. We are excited to step onto the
worlds biggest and most varied culinary stage. We think New Yorkers are in for a treat.

About Panera Bread Company
As of September 27, 2011, Panera Bread Company owned and franchised 1,504 bakery-cafes under the
Panera Bread, Saint Louis Bread Co. and Paradise Bakery & Caf names. Our bakery-cafes areprincipally located in suburban, strip mall, and regional mall locations. We feature high quality,
reasonably priced food in a warm, inviting, and comfortable environment. With our identity rooted in
handcrafted, fresh-baked, artisan bread, we are committed to providing great tasting, quality food that
people can trust. Nearly all of our bakery-cafes have a menu highlighted by antibiotic-free chicken, whole
grain bread, and select organic and all natural ingredients, with zero grams of artificial trans fat per
serving, which provide flavorful, wholesome offerings. Our menu includes a wide variety of year-round
favorites complemented by new items introduced seasonally with the goal of creating new standards in
everyday food choices. In neighborhoods across the United States and in Ontario, Canada, our customers
enjoy our warm and welcoming environment featuring comfortable gathering areas, relaxing decor, and
free internet access. Our bakery-cafes routinely donate bread and baked goods to community
organizations in need. Additional information is available on our website, http://www.panerabread.com .
